Furnace Not Turning On in Berwick

A furnace that does not respond to a thermostat call for heat has a specific electrical or control fault preventing startup in Berwick, LA. Failed igniter. Failed flame sensor preventing the gas valve from opening. Tripped high-limit switch from a previous overheating event. Failed control board. Thermostat wiring fault or failed thermostat. Gas supply issue in Berwick. Air America diagnoses no-heat situations systematically beginning with the most common and most correctable causes in Berwick, LA.

Furnace Running But Not Heating in Berwick, LA

A furnace that is running its blower but producing no heat or minimal heat has a specific combustion system fault in Berwick. Failed igniter that is running the blower but not lighting the burners. Gas valve that is not opening despite the igniter firing. Burner ports so contaminated that the flame is not establishing correctly in Berwick, LA. Air America diagnoses the specific combustion fault before recommending any repair in Berwick.

Insufficient Heat — System Runs But Rooms Stay Cold in Berwick

A furnace that runs normally but does not adequately heat the home has a capacity or distribution problem in Berwick, LA. Contaminated heat exchanger reducing thermal efficiency. Dirty burners producing incomplete combustion and reduced heat output. Duct system leakage delivering conditioned air to unconditioned spaces. Or an undersized system for the home's actual heat loss in Berwick.

Furnace Short Cycling in Berwick, LA

A furnace that starts, runs for a short period, and shuts off repeatedly without completing a full heating cycle is short cycling in Berwick. The most common cause is the high-limit switch tripping because restricted airflow is causing the heat exchanger to overheat in Berwick, LA. A dirty filter that is severely restricting return airflow is the most common cause of limit switch tripping in Berwick.

Unusual Smells From the Heating System in Berwick

A burning or dusty smell at the start of the heating season that clears within a few minutes is typically dust burning off the heat exchanger and is not a safety concern in Berwick, LA. A persistent burning smell that does not clear, a burning plastic smell indicating an electrical fault, or a rotten egg or sulfur smell indicating a gas leak are situations requiring the furnace to be shut off and Air America called immediately in Berwick.

Unusual Sounds From the Furnace in Berwick, LA

A banging or booming sound at startup indicates delayed ignition from dirty burners where gas accumulates before igniting in Berwick. A squealing sound from the air handler indicates a failing blower motor bearing in Berwick, LA. A rattling sound during operation may indicate a loose heat exchanger component in Berwick.

Heat Pump Not Heating in Cold Weather in Berwick, LA

A heat pump that is not heating adequately in moderate cold may have a refrigerant issue, a reversing valve fault, or a defrost system problem in Berwick. In very cold temperatures, supplemental electric heat strips provide additional heating capacity that should engage automatically when the heat pump alone cannot meet the heating load in Berwick, LA.

What Causes Heating Failures

What Causes Heating Systems to Fail in Berwick, LA

Ignition System Failures — Igniter and Flame Sensor in Berwick

The igniter in a modern gas furnace is a hot surface igniter that glows red-hot to ignite the gas burners in Berwick, LA. Igniters are fragile ceramic components that become brittle over time and crack or fail from normal thermal cycling in Berwick. The flame sensor confirms a flame is present before allowing the gas valve to remain open in Berwick, LA. Oxidation reduces its conductivity, producing a furnace that starts and shuts off after a few seconds in Berwick.

Heat Exchanger Cracks — The Safety-Critical Fault in Berwick, LA

The heat exchanger separates combustion gases from the circulated air in Berwick. A cracked heat exchanger allows combustion gases including carbon monoxide to cross into the circulated air and be distributed throughout the home by the blower in Berwick, LA. A confirmed cracked heat exchanger means the furnace should not be operated until the heat exchanger or furnace is replaced in Berwick.

Gas Valve and Pressure Issues in Berwick, LA

The gas valve controls the flow of gas to the burners in Berwick. A failed gas valve prevents gas from reaching the burners regardless of whether the igniter is functioning correctly in Berwick, LA. Low gas pressure reduces the heat output of the burners in Berwick. Air America assesses gas valve operation and gas pressure on every gas furnace service in Berwick, LA.

Blower Motor and Capacitor Failure in Berwick

The blower motor moves conditioned air through the duct system in Berwick, LA. A failed blower motor produces no airflow despite the combustion system operating correctly, causing the heat exchanger to overheat and the high-limit switch to trip in Berwick. A failing blower motor capacitor causes the motor to struggle to start or fail to start entirely in Berwick, LA.

Control Board and Thermostat Faults in Berwick, LA

The control board manages ignition sequencing, blower timing, safety switch monitoring, and fault code storage in modern gas furnaces in Berwick. A failed control board can produce a wide range of symptoms depending on which function it was managing in Berwick, LA.

Limit Switch Trips From Overheating in Berwick

The high-limit switch shuts the furnace off if the heat exchanger temperature exceeds the safe maximum in Berwick, LA. A limit switch that is tripping consistently indicates restricted airflow causing the heat exchanger to reach unsafe temperatures in Berwick. A dirty air filter is the most common cause in Berwick, LA.

Safety — Know When to Stop the System

The Safety Dimension of Heating System Repair in Berwick, LA

Carbon Monoxide — When to Stop Using the Heating System Immediately in Berwick

Carbon monoxide is the combustion byproduct that presents the most serious immediate safety risk from a faulty gas heating system in Berwick, LA. It is colorless and odorless and produces symptoms including headache, dizziness, nausea, and confusion in Berwick. If your carbon monoxide detector activates during heating system operation, evacuate the home immediately, call emergency services from outside the home, and then call Air America in Berwick, LA. Do not re-enter the home until emergency services have confirmed it is safe in Berwick.

Heat Exchanger Cracks and Why They Cannot Be Deferred in Berwick, LA

A confirmed cracked heat exchanger is not a condition that can be managed carefully while a convenient repair date is found in Berwick. A cracked heat exchanger allows combustion gases including carbon monoxide to enter the circulated air with every heating cycle in Berwick, LA. Air America's recommendation for a confirmed cracked heat exchanger is to cease operation of the furnace until the heat exchanger or furnace is replaced in Berwick.

Gas Leak Signs and the Correct Response in Berwick

A rotten egg or sulfur smell near the furnace or gas lines indicates a gas leak in Berwick, LA. The correct response is to not operate any electrical switches including light switches and thermostats, evacuate the home, and call the gas utility from outside the home in Berwick. Do not re-enter until the gas utility has confirmed the leak is repaired and the area is safe in Berwick, LA.

The most common causes of a furnace that stops working between uses in Berwick are a flame sensor that is failing and producing inconsistent flame confirmation, a high-limit switch that is tripping from restricted airflow and resetting when the furnace cools, a control board fault producing intermittent startup failures, and a thermostat issue including failed batteries in Berwick, LA.
A furnace that starts its ignition sequence and shuts off after a few seconds almost always has a flame sensor problem in Berwick. The furnace ignites the burners, the flame sensor fails to confirm the flame within the safety window, and the control board shuts the gas valve as a safety measure in Berwick, LA. Flame sensor cleaning or replacement addresses this in most cases in Berwick.
A cracked heat exchanger allows combustion gases including carbon monoxide to enter the air that the blower circulates through the home in Berwick. Carbon monoxide exposure causes headache, dizziness, nausea, and at sufficient concentrations is life-threatening in Berwick, LA. A confirmed cracked heat exchanger means the furnace should not be operated until the heat exchanger or furnace is replaced in Berwick.
A brief burning or dusty smell at the start of the heating season that clears within a few minutes is typically dust burning off the heat exchanger after the summer off-season in Berwick. This is generally not a safety concern in Berwick, LA. A persistent burning smell that does not clear, a burning plastic smell, or any smell that worsens over time warrants shutting the furnace off and calling Air America in Berwick.
A heat pump producing cold air in heating mode typically has a reversing valve stuck in cooling position, low refrigerant reducing heating capacity, or a defrost system issue causing the outdoor coil to ice over in Berwick. In very cold temperatures, a heat pump that is operating correctly may produce supply air that feels cool relative to gas furnace output because heat pumps operate at lower supply air temperatures than gas furnaces in Berwick, LA.
The reliable way to detect carbon monoxide from the furnace is a working carbon monoxide detector positioned near the furnace and on every sleeping floor in Berwick. Symptoms of carbon monoxide exposure including headache, dizziness, and nausea that improve when leaving the home are an indicator in Berwick, LA. Air America measures carbon monoxide in the circulated air as a standard component of every gas furnace service in Berwick.
The flame sensor is a safety component that confirms a flame is present before the control board allows the gas valve to stay open in Berwick. Oxidation on the sensor rod reduces its electrical conductivity over time, causing it to produce a signal too weak to satisfy the control board in Berwick, LA. The control board shuts the gas valve as a safety measure, producing the furnace that starts and shuts off in seconds symptom in Berwick.
A banging or booming sound at furnace startup indicates delayed ignition in Berwick. Gas accumulates in the combustion chamber before the burners ignite because the burner ports are partially blocked by combustion deposits, producing a small explosion when ignition finally occurs in Berwick, LA. Delayed ignition is hard on the heat exchanger and warrants prompt burner cleaning in Berwick.
Yes. A severely restricted air filter reduces the airflow through the heat exchanger below the minimum required for safe operation in Berwick. The heat exchanger temperature rises to the point where the high-limit switch trips and shuts the furnace off in Berwick, LA. Replacing the filter allows the furnace to operate within safe temperature parameters in Berwick.
Most common heating repairs including flame sensor replacement, igniter replacement, and capacitor replacement take one to two hours in Berwick. More complex repairs including control board replacement, gas valve replacement, and heat exchanger replacement take two to four hours or more in Berwick, LA.
